After more consideration on this, we think that we can remove those macros which introduce confusions, and just pass 0 to ACPI core for the max entries of GICC structure or GICR structure, ACPI core will continue scan all the entries in MADT with 0 passed. With that, we can avoid such name confusions for all GIC related structures in MADT no matter GICv2 or GICv3/4. Thanks Hanjun
